| dc.description.abstract | Background: The aim of this study was to assess the trabecularbone pattern changes of orthodontically treated patients beforeorthodontic treatment (T0), immediately after (T1) and 6 monthsafter (T2) the treatment by using fractal dimension (FD) analysisin order to guide implant applications.Methods: Totally 32 orthodontic patients who had one missingtooth were included in the study. Patients were treated to alignthe teeth and to create a dimensionally appropriate space forimplant placement. Panoramic radiographs were taken withstandard protocols at the time periods of before (T0),immediately after (T1) and 6 months after (T2) treatment. FDanalysis was performed using Image J 1.3 software with the boxcounting method.Results: The highest FD value was measured before treatment(T0=1.47±0.14). Mean FD values of T2 was found statisticallysignificantly higher (1.32±0.14) than T1 (1.19±0.15) (p<0.001).Conclusion: It is suggested not to plan implant surgeryimmediately after the end of orthodontic treatment becausetrabecular bone gains more complex nature over time. FDanalysis is a simple and cost-effective tool for examining bonestructure in panoramic radiographs. | |
